History comes alive for pupils at 14, Henrietta Street

The children in Mr Smyth’s 4th Class had a wonderful visit to 14, Henrietta Street, as part of their History lessons about homes in the past and about life in the past in tenement Dublin.

During the visit the children took a trip through time from the 1700’s as a home for some Dublin’s wealthiest families, in this case Lord Viscount Molesworth and his wife through to the 1900s when over 100 people lived in camped tenement conditions there.
